/**
* Checks if a point passes across a line, either direction
* See the wiki Mark Rounding algorithm for more info
*
* @param mark1 One mark of the line
* @param mark2 The second mark of the line
* @param lastLocation The last location of the point crossing this line
* @param location The current location of the point crossing this line
* @return True if crossed since last location --> current location, false otherwise
*/
public static Boolean checkCrossedLine(GeoPoint mark1, GeoPoint mark2, GeoPoint lastLocation,
GeoPoint location) {
//START GATE OR FINISH GATE
Double alpha = GeoUtility.getBearing(mark1, lastLocation);
Double beta = GeoUtility.getBearing(mark1, mark2);
Double theta = GeoUtility.getBearing(mark1, location);
alpha = (alpha > 180) ? 360 - alpha : alpha;
beta = (beta > 180) ? 360 - beta : beta;
theta = (theta > 180) ? 360 - theta : theta;
if (alpha < beta && theta > beta) {
if (!GeoUtility.isPointInTriangle(mark1, lastLocation, location, mark2)) {
return true;
}
}
return false;
}
